Charlie Sheen is a very protective father – and he isn’t apologizing for the outrageous act that he asked his fans to do. He says his 9-year-old daughter Sam was bullied so bad a year ago that she never wanted to go back. So Charlie and Denise Richards took her out of Viewpoint School in Calabasas. When Charlie brought up the bullying to the school, he says the school called his daughter a liar and didn’t deal with the problem. After a few months of no action from the school, Charlie said his anger reached a boiling point – and on Twitter, he asked fans to go to the private school and smear rotten eggs and dog “waste” on the premises. After the school released a statement saying they investigated the allegation last year and took appropriate action. Charlie won’t apologize – and said the school needed a visual reminder not to forget the epidemic of bullying.

Alex Trebek’s “Jeopardy” contract will come to an end in 2016 and if he decides not to renew, there is already a list of people interested in the job. So who is at the top of the list? “Today Show” host Matt Lauer! His morning show contract goes through 2015 – which potentially makes him available to host Jeopardy. He may have some competition, however, as Anderson Cooper is also a potential contender.

A few days ago Val was asking what happened to Sanjaya from American Idol? Well, he’s been found!  …And he is singing for change for people taking the New York City Subway. Sanjaya came in 7th place on season six of American Idol – and instead of performing on stage, he is singing for passengers at First Avenue (L) station in New York. His song of choice: Otis Redding's "(Sittin' On) The Dock of the Bay."
